Estender aplicativos do Teams pelo Microsoft 365
Com as versões mais recentes da biblioteca de clientes JavaScript do Microsoft Teams (TeamsJS versão 2.0.0 e posterior), manifesto de aplicativo (anteriormente chamado de manifesto de aplicativo do Teams) (versão 1.13 e posterior) e Kit de Ferramentas do Teams, você pode criar e atualizar aplicativos do Teams para executar em outros produtos microsoft 365 de alto uso e publicá-los no Microsoft Commercial Marketplace (Microsoft AppSource) ou na loja de aplicativos privada da sua organização.
Estender seu aplicativo do Teams pelo Microsoft 365 fornece uma maneira simplificada de fornecer aplicativos entre plataformas para um público de usuário expandido: a partir de uma única base de código, você pode criar experiências de aplicativo personalizadas para ambientes de aplicativos teams, Outlook e Microsoft 365. Os usuários finais não precisam sair do contexto de seu trabalho para usar seu aplicativo e os administradores se beneficiam de um fluxo de trabalho de gerenciamento e implantação consolidado.
A plataforma de aplicativos do Teams continua a evoluir e expandir de forma holística para o ecossistema do Microsoft 365. Aqui está o suporte atual dos elementos da plataforma de aplicativos do Teams no Microsoft 365 (Teams, Outlook e Microsoft 365 como hosts de aplicativo):
Recursos do aplicativo Teams | Elemento manifesto do aplicativo | Suporte do Teams | Suporte ao Outlook | Suporte a aplicativos do Microsoft 365 | Observações |
---|---|---|---|---|---|
Escopo tabs-personal | staticTabs |
Web, Desktop, Mobile | Web, Desktop, Mobile (Android, iOS) | Web, Desktop, Mobile (Android, iOS) | Não há suporte para escopos de canal e grupo para o Microsoft 365. Para obter mais informações, consulte Biblioteca de clientes JavaScript do Teams. |
Aplicativos de reunião | configurableTabs |
Web, Desktop, Mobile | Desktop | - | Não há suporte para o Meeting Stageview no Outlook. Confira anotações. |
Baseado em extensões de mensagens baseadas em pesquisa | composeExtensions |
Web, Desktop, Mobile | Web, Área de Trabalho | - | Para obter limitações e solução de problemas, consulte anotações. |
Extensões de mensagem baseadas em ação | composeExtensions |
Web, Desktop, Mobile | Web | - | Exibivel/acionável (não compatível) na versão prévia móvel do Teams/Outlook (iOS, Android). Para obter limitações e solução de problemas, consulte anotações. |
Desenrolamento de link (incluindo Stageview) | composeExtensions.messageHandlers |
Web, Área de Trabalho | Web, Área de Trabalho | - | Confira anotações sobre a desenrolação do link e a visão de estágio |
Componentes do Loop de Cartão Adaptável | composeExtensions.messageHandlers |
Web, Área de Trabalho | Web, Desktop (somente para novo Outlook) | - | Acessível (não compatível) na versão prévia móvel do Teams/Outlook (iOS, Android). Confira anotações. |
Visão de estágio | composeExtensions.messageHandlers |
Web, Desktop, Mobile | Web (versão prévia), Área de Trabalho (versão prévia) | - | Exibivel/acionável (não compatível) na versão prévia móvel do Outlook (iOS, Android). Confira anotações. |
Suplementos do Outlook | extensions |
- | Web, Área de Trabalho | - | Confira anotações. |
O registro no Microsoft 365 Targeted Release e Microsoft 365 Apps canal de atualização requer a opção de administrador para toda a organização ou usuários selecionados. Os canais de atualização são específicos do dispositivo e se aplicam apenas às instalações do Microsoft 365 em execução no Windows.
Observação
Para obter mais informações sobre diretrizes de administrador e opções para gerenciar seu aplicativo estendido do Teams, confira Aplicativos do Teams que funcionam no Outlook e no Microsoft 365.
Para obter diretrizes sobre o manifesto do aplicativo e as diretrizes de versão do TeamsJS e mais detalhes sobre o suporte atual à plataforma do Teams no Microsoft 365, consulte a visão geral da biblioteca de clientes JavaScript do Teams.
Guias pessoais no Outlook e no aplicativo Microsoft 365
Acesse seus usuários onde eles estão, bem no contexto de seu trabalho estendendo seu aplicativo Web como um aplicativo de guia pessoal do Teams que também é executado no Outlook e no aplicativo Microsoft 365. As guias pessoais do Teams criadas e hospedadas com Estrutura do SharePoint (SPFx) versão 1.16 e posterior também têm suporte no Outlook e no aplicativo Microsoft 365.
No celular, você pode testar e depurar sua guia pessoal do Teams em execução no Microsoft 365 para aplicativo iOS e Android, além do Outlook para aplicativo iOS e Android.
Extensões de mensagem no Outlook
Você pode estender suas extensões de mensagens do Teams para Outlook na Web e Windows, além de clientes do Microsoft Teams.
A desenrolação de link funciona nos ambientes Web e Windows do Outlook da mesma forma que acontece no Microsoft Teams sem nenhum trabalho adicional do que usar o manifesto do aplicativo versão 1.13 ou posterior. Você também pode desenrolar links com cartões que iniciam o Stageview.
Crie seu aplicativo com o manifesto de aplicativo mais recente e a biblioteca de clientes JavaScript do Teams para beneficiar o mais recente processo consolidado de desenvolvimento de aplicativos do Microsoft 365. Em seguida, forneça uma experiência simplificada de implantação, instalação e administrador para seus clientes que expanda o alcance e o uso do seu aplicativo.
Aplicativos de reunião no Outlook
Os usuários podem descobrir e usar seu aplicativo de reunião diretamente no fluxo de seu trabalho quando você estende seu aplicativo de reunião para o Outlook para Windows.
Usar manifesto de aplicativo no Microsoft 365
Com o objetivo de simplificar e simplificar o ecossistema de desenvolvedores do Microsoft 365, continuamos expandindo o manifesto do aplicativo para outras áreas do Microsoft 365 com o seguinte.
Suplementos do Outlook
Agora você pode definir e implantar suplementos do Outlook na versão 1.17 e posterior do manifesto do aplicativo.
Para obter mais informações, consulte manifesto de aplicativo para suplementos do Office.
Planejamento e design de aplicativos
Para criar um aplicativo dentro do ecossistema do Microsoft 365, considere como ele ajuda seus usuários a executar seu trabalho e concluir suas tarefas diárias. Ao ser atencioso com seu planejamento e design de aplicativo, você pode criar uma experiência mais integrada e introduz menos atrito para os usuários com seu aplicativo.
Para começar a usar aplicativos estendidos no Microsoft 365, confira playbooks de aplicativo e visualização do Kit de Interface do Usuário do Microsoft 365 (Figma).
Ações no Microsoft 365
As ações visam integrar seu aplicativo ao fluxo de trabalho do usuário, permitindo fácil descoberta e interação contínua com seu conteúdo. Ao direcionar os usuários para seu aplicativo com sua intenção e conteúdo contextual, as ações habilitam a conclusão eficiente da tarefa. Essa integração aprimora a visibilidade e o engajamento do seu aplicativo com o mínimo esforço de desenvolvimento.
Para obter mais informações, confira Ações no Microsoft 365
Envio do marketplace comercial da Microsoft
Junte-se ao crescente número de aplicativos do Teams de produção na loja do Microsoft Commercial Marketplace (Microsoft AppSource) com suporte expandido para o público do Outlook e do Microsoft 365. O processo de envio de aplicativo para aplicativos do Teams habilitados para Outlook e Microsoft 365 é o mesmo dos aplicativos tradicionais do Teams. A única diferença é usar o manifesto de aplicativo versão 1.13 ou posterior em seu pacote de aplicativos, o que apresenta suporte para aplicativos do Teams executados no Microsoft 365.
Depois que seu aplicativo for publicado como um aplicativo do Teams habilitado para Microsoft 365, seu aplicativo será detectável como um aplicativo instalável nas lojas de aplicativos do Outlook e do Microsoft 365, além da Microsoft Teams Store. Ao executar no Outlook e no aplicativo Microsoft 365, seu aplicativo usa as mesmas permissões concedidas no Teams. Os administradores do Teams podem gerenciar o acesso a aplicativos do Teams no Microsoft 365 para usuários em sua organização.
Para obter mais informações, consulte publicar aplicativos do Teams para o Microsoft 365.
Próxima etapa
Configure seu ambiente de desenvolvimento para criar aplicativos do Teams para o Microsoft 365:
Confira também
Comentários
https://aka.ms/ContentUserFeedback.
Em breve: Ao longo de 2024, eliminaremos os problemas do GitHub como o mecanismo de comentários para conteúdo e o substituiremos por um novo sistema de comentários. Para obter mais informações, consulteEnviar e exibir comentários de